Responsibilities
  • Patrol facilities and property in a police car, on foot, by bicycle or other appropriate means; check doors and windows; examine premises of unoccupied buildings; detect unusual conditions, may maintain surveillance and observation for stolen cars, missing persons, or suspects; report dangerous or defective streets, sidewalks, traffic signals, or other hazardous conditions.
  • Fixed Post Functions Emergency Department/Hospital Concourse–Control patient and visitor entry as appropriate into the E.D. Operate metal screening system to prevent weapons or other contraband from entering the patient treatment area. Control the entrance of visitors and employees after hours at designated entrances as well as screens for proper authorization and identification.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of emergency codes and First Health Police response procedures. Assist with mental health patient custody issues and assist in both arranging transportation to other facilities as well as escorting patients to units within the First Health system. Control disruptive patients.
  • Respond to calls for assistance, complaints, suspicious activity, domestic disputes, loud and disruptive behavior, and other needs; complete calls by determining true nature of the situation and taking whatever legal or persuasive action is warranted.
  • Investigate traffic accidents; illegal parking; issue traffic citations; direct traffic and participate in other emergency operation activities.
  • Perform investigations of accidents and possible crimes through observation, questioning witnesses, and gathering physical evidence; perform investigative tasks assigned by the Police Sergeant or other senior officer; arrest and process criminal suspects.
  • Advise the public on laws and local ordinances; testify in court; execute search warrants; serve papers as needed.
  • Regulate and direct vehicular traffic at busy times or when traffic signal malfunctions or accidents require; maintain order at public gatherings.
  • Perform bank escorts.
  • Operate a two‑way radio to receive instructions and information from or to report information to police headquarters; operate mobile data terminal with a variety of software.
  • Prepare detailed records and reports of activities.
  • Perform related duties as required.
Qualifications

Graduation from high school and completion of basic law enforcement training; experience preferred;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.

Possession of a valid NC driver's license or the ability to get a NC driver’s license. Certification by the North Carolina Justice Training and Standards Commission as a law enforcement officer or the ability to complete the NC BLET “Transfer” course.

High level of computer literacy and technical competency, office automation skills; strong time management and organizational skills; ability to multi‑task and participate in multiple projects at one time; strong interpersonal and verbal skills to include telephone skills and strong customer service focus; strong writing skills; self‑motiving.
